Frequently Asked Questions

Which company pays higher H1B salaries, Dallas Independent School District or The City College of New York?
The City College of New York pays higher H1B salaries with a median of $114,462 compared to Dallas Independent School District's $70,030.
Which company sponsors more H1B visas, Dallas Independent School District or The City College of New York?
Dallas Independent School District has sponsored more H1B visas with 3,813 total filings compared to The City College of New York's 94.
How do Dallas Independent School District and The City College of New York H1B approval rates compare?
Dallas Independent School District has a 100.0% H1B approval rate while The City College of New York has 100.0%. Both companies have the same approval rate.
